Use the slope formula to find the missing coordinate. M=-7/2, T (13,2), W (_,-5)

    M = (y₂-y₁) / (x₂-x₁) that is the formula

    so plug in the numbers

    -7/2 = (-5-2) / _-13

    so - 5-2 gives you - 7

    _-13 gives you 2

    so the blank is 15
